During the maple syrup production season, responsibilities at a Sugar Shack typically include tapping trees, collecting sap, operating evaporation and filtering equipment, and bottling finished syrup. Many Sugar Shacks also host visitors, so duties may extend to giving educational tours, serving meals, or managing a retail shop. Teamwork is important, as the production process requires close coordination among seasonal workers and operators, especially during peak flow days. Job seekers should be prepared for physically demanding work and variable hours based on weather conditions, as well as a fast-paced, community-oriented environment.
